Najlepsze praktyki lazy loading dla pozycjonowania
Lazy loading to technika, która może znacząco wpłynąć na szybkość ładowania strony oraz doświadczenie użytkowników, co z kolei korzystnie odbija się na pozycjonowaniu w wyszukiwarkach. Kluczowe jest jednak, aby stosować ją zgodnie z najlepszymi praktykami, aby nie narazić się na problemy z indeksowaniem przez roboty wyszukiwarek. Pierwszym krokiem jest upewnienie się, że wszystkie elementy, które są załadowane po przewinięciu strony, są odpowiednio oznaczone. Warto zadbać o to, aby używać atrybutów, takich jak „loading=lazy”, które wskazują przeglądarkom, które obrazy powinny być załadowane w momencie, gdy użytkownik znajduje się w ich zasięgu wzrokowym. Zwracanie uwagi na odpowiednie lokalizacje dla tych atrybutów oraz kontrolowanie, kiedy zasoby są ładowane, może znacząco wpłynąć na czas ładowania głównych treści, co jest jednym z kryteriów oceny przez Google.
Podczas projektowania strony z zastosowaniem lazy loading, niezbędne jest także przemyślenie hierarchii treści. Warto, aby przyciągające uwagę obrazy oraz istotne elementy umieszczone były na początku strony, co zapewni ich szybkie załadowanie i zmniejszy ryzyko frustracji użytkowników. Pamiętajmy, że dziś użytkownicy oczekują natychmiastowych odpowiedzi, a zbyt długie oczekiwanie na wczytanie się materiałów może skutkować ich odejściem z witryny. Stosowanie placeholderów, które będą wyświetlały się zamiast obrazów podczas ich ładowania, jest również dobrym pomysłem. Taki zabieg nie tylko poprawi wrażenia użytkowników, ale także zminimalizuje negatywne skutki związane z opóźnieniami w ładowaniu. Ponadto, pomocne jest korzystanie z technik kompresji obrazów, aby zredukować ich rozmiar przed aplikacją lazy loading, co przyspiesza wczytywanie widocznych sekcji strony.
Znaczenie responsywności również nie może być pominięte przy implementacji lazy loading. Witryna powinna być dostosowana do różnych urządzeń, a przy tych ustawieniach konieczne jest również, aby obrazy i inne zasoby były optymalizowane pod kątem wyświetlania na tych urządzeniach. Implementując lazy loading, warto skorzystać z tzw. techniki „adaptive loading”, gdzie zasoby są dopasowywane nie tylko do warunków przewijania, ale także do specyfiki urządzenia użytkownika i jego połączenia internetowego. Tego rodzaju podejście nie tylko wpływa na poprawę szybkości ładowania, ale także wspiera lepszą jakość doświadczeń użytkowników. Cały proces korzystania z lazy loading w kontekście SEO powinien być traktowany jako element całościowej strategii optymalizacji strony, obejmującej także inne aspekty techniczne i jakościowe, co w ostateczności przyczyni się do lepszej widoczności w wyszukiwarkach.
Zalety lazy loading w SEO
Lazy loading przynosi szereg istotnych zalet w kontekście pozycjonowania stron internetowych. Przede wszystkim, główną korzyścią jest poprawa czasów ładowania strony, co jest kluczowym czynnikiem ocenianym przez wyszukiwarki. W dzisiejszych czasach użytkownicy oczekują szybkiego dostępu do treści, a wolno ładująca się strona może prowadzić do frustracji i szybkiego opuszczania witryny. Dzięki zastosowaniu tej techniki, elementy wizualne, takie jak obrazy czy filmy, będą wczytywane tylko wtedy, gdy znajdują się w polu widzenia użytkownika, co znacząco obniża obciążenie serwera oraz czas oczekiwania na załadowanie strony. Skrócenie tego czasu nie tylko poprawia doświadczenie użytkownika, ale również wpływa pozytywnie na wskaźniki SEO, takie jak współczynnik odrzuceń i czas spędzony na stronie, które są obserwowane przez algorytmy wyszukiwarek.
Dodatkowo, zastosowanie lazy loading zmniejsza zużycie danych, co może być szczególnie ważne dla użytkowników korzystających z urządzeń mobilnych lub ograniczonych planów danych. W dzisiejszych czasach coraz więcej osób przegląda internet na smartfonach i tabletach, dlatego optymalizacja ładowania zasobów jest kluczowa. Gdy obrazy i inne elementy wczytywane są tylko wtedy, gdy są potrzebne, zmniejsza to nie tylko czas ładowania, ale również zużycie bandwithu. To podejście sprzyja lepszemu dopasowaniu się do oczekiwań użytkowników, co w rezultacie przekłada się na dłuższy czas spędzony na stronie. Ruch z urządzeń mobilnych jest coraz bardziej zróżnicowany, więc skorzystanie z upowszechniającej się technologii lazy loading może być kluczem do poprawy dostępności witryny na różnych platformach.
Nie można również zapominać o pozytywnym wpływie stosowania lazy loading na SEO związany z indeksowaniem treści. Gdy elementy strony ładują się po przewinięciu, istnieje mniejsze ryzyko, że roboty wyszukiwarek będą miały problemy z ich zauważeniem. Prawidłowe ustawienie lazy loading pozwala na efektywne indeksowanie, co z kolei zwiększa prawdopodobieństwo, że strona będzie w wyszukiwarkach wyżej pozycjonowana. Kluczowe jest, aby podczas implementacji tej techniki, dbać o to, by wszystkie istotne treści były dostępne dla robotów. Optymalizacja tego procesu powinna obejmować zarówno techniczne aspekty, jak i treści, które mają być prezentowane użytkownikom. Ostatecznym celem jest tworzenie doświadczenia, które sprzyja zarówno użytkownikom, jak i wyszukiwarkom, co w dłuższej perspektywie przyczyni się do osiągnięcia lepszych wyników w SERP-ach.
Techniki implementacji lazy loading
Wprowadzając lazy loading, fundamentalne znaczenie ma dobór odpowiednich technik implementacji, które dostosują tę funkcję do specyfiki danej strony internetowej. Kluczowym krokiem jest zrozumienie, że wdrożenie lazy loading opiera się na pełnej strategii optymalizacyjnej, gdzie każdy element ma znaczenie. W szczególności, należy zacząć od zidentyfikowania wszystkich obrazów i zasobów, które są ładowane na stronie, a następnie określenia, które z nich można bezpiecznie przesunąć w procesie ładowania. Warto przy tym pamiętać, że istotne jest, aby ważne treści oraz obrazy, które przyciągają uwagę użytkowników, były dostępne od razu, podczas gdy mniej znaczące elementy mogą być ładowane później. Tego rodzaju podejście nie tylko poprawia wrażenia użytkowników, ale również zmniejsza pojemność zasobów do wczytania, co przyspiesza czasy ładowania strony i sprzyja lepszemu pozycjonowaniu.
Wdrażanie techniki lazy loading można realizować na różne sposoby, w zależności od preferencji i struktury witryny. Jedną z najczęściej stosowanych metod jest przeniesienie ładowania obrazów do momentu ich potrzebnego wyświetlenia, co można osiągnąć przez odpowiednie ustawienia w ramach kodu HTML. Ważne jest, aby stosować atrybuty, które informują przeglądarki o tym, kiedy załadować dane obrazy. Dobrze zaprojektowane witryny stosują również technikę tzw. „placeholderów”, które wyświetlają się zamiast obrazów w momencie, gdy są nawigowane przez użytkownika. Te tymczasowe obrazy lub kontenery mogą być zaprojektowane w taki sposób, aby pasowały do docelowych wymiarów, co pozwala uniknąć nieestetycznych przeskoków w layoucie strony, gdy właściwe obrazy zostaną wczytane. Niezwykle istotne jest, aby wszystkie te techniki były implementowane w zgodzie z ogólnymi praktykami SEO, by roboty wyszukiwarek miały możliwość prawidłowego indeksowania treści.
Inną istotną techniką jest wykorzystanie tzw. „event listenerów”, które monitorują przewijanie strony i zwracają uwagę na położenie elementów. Warto zastosować odpowiednie algorytmy, które będą reagować na ruch użytkownika, uruchamiając ładowanie zasobów dokładnie w momencie, gdy stają się one widoczne na ekranie. Aby zrealizować pełnię potencjału lazy loading, powinno się również rozważyć wykorzystanie zewnętrznych bibliotek, które mogą uprościć ten proces, zapewniając jednocześnie, że optymalizacja nie zostanie zaburzona. Wszelkie techniki implementacji lazy loading powinny być dostosowane do specyfiki projektu oraz platformy CMS, na której działa strona. Warto przeprowadzać regularne testy, aby upewnić się, że wszystkie zastosowane rozwiązania funkcjonują poprawnie i nie wpływają negatywnie na wrażenia użytkowników czy na pozycjonowanie w wyszukiwarkach. Wspólna praca tych elementów sprawi, że strona stanie się odporniejsza na sugestie związane z ładowaniem zasobów, poprawiając tym samym jej widoczność w sieci.